Life care plan for a child suffering from cerebral palsy

To be able to claim compensation, it is crucial to develop a Life Care Plan. The plan's purpose is to identify the future needs of the child. It is designed by medical experts and provides an outline for parents. It provides the equipment and services necessary for the child's growth.

The plan should contain specific treatments, medications, and services. It should also estimate the total cost of these services. These costs are broken down by age group and the length of their annual period.

In addition to the medical costs, the plan for health should also be mindful of the requirements for support services and other items. These services can be provided by the government or in the private sector. They could include counseling services that assist families struggling with adjustment issues.

To assist parents in creating an overall plan for their lives, it is important to find a qualified Life Planning professional. They are experts at working with children with special needs. They can help the parents decide on how much money is needed for their child's future.

The first step in establishing an appropriate life-care plan is gathering details regarding the child's injuries. This includes information about the incident, the method by which it was created, as well as the impact the injury has had on the child. This information is used to write an report. The report will include the child's current condition as well as diagnosis as and a table that can be used to estimate the need for future treatment and services.

The report should provide information about the specific symptoms of the condition. This could include the child's movement range and muscle tone as well as the delay in completing developmental milestones. It could also include suggestions from doctors and therapists.

The report should also include information on the economic effects of the injury. These could include the loss of the child's life in terms of pain or suffering. Also, it should include the cost of the minor's loss of earning capacity.
